PR and Communications Officer

At Beatson Cancer Charity we support and enhance the treatment, care and wellbeing of current, former and future cancer patients and their families. We work in partnership with the NHS, The Beatson West of Scotland Cancer Centre and all related facilities. We also offer the wider community a unique opportunity to contribute to the fight against cancer in the broadest possible sense.

Title:PR and Communications Officer

Reporting to:Marketing and Communications Manager

Salary:£27,500 - £30,000 (depending on experience)

Contract:Permanent, full time

Hours:35 hours per week, flexibility to work evenings and weekends, as required

Annual Leave:40 days per annum (inclusive of Public Holidays)

Pension:7% employer and 3% employee contribution

We are currently seeking a PR and Communications Officer who will contribute to PR campaigns and activity that support Beatson Cancer Charity's objectives and help maintain an effective press office service on a day-to-day basis, delivering results and being able to demonstrate success through robust evaluation.

Key Responsibilities

Media Relations:

· Deliver a timely, accurate response to media enquiries, leading on handling external requests professionally and effectively.

· To originate, produce and distribute effective support materials, such as Q&As, media briefings and lines to take.

· Organise and manage photo calls as required.

· Produce and support PR activities such as: copywriting for press releases, feature articles and other forms of public relations resources.

· Contribute creative ideas to generate content for news stories and features.

· Be aware of the national news agenda identifying opportunities and bringing issues to the attention of the Marketing and Communications Manager as appropriate.

· Maintain awareness and knowledge of initiatives across Beatson Cancer Charity and wider organisations that can add value to delivery of the Charity's objectives.

· Ensure that all media work reflects the Charity's values.

· To lead production of a monthly media monitoring report evaluating volume, tone and value of Beatson Cancer Charity's media coverage.

PR:

· To identify opportunities to promote Beatson Cancer Charity and its services via press, public relations, digital media and other marketing channels.

· To assist with the development of corporate publications and input to digital communications including social media.

· Manage the PR, media and publication budget in conjunction with the Marketing and Communications Manager.

· Undertake appropriate crisis communications/reputation management processes as required.

· Support internal communications activities as appropriate.

Monitoring Impact:

· Be responsible for up-to-date media monitoring and archive materials including external subscriptions; evaluating media coverage and PR activity for internal and external reports or for project evaluation.

· Assist with ongoing reviews and evaluations of whether the Charity is reaching the right audiences and achieving communications goals.

Relationship Management:

· Develop and maintain a strong network of media contacts, journalists, and influencers ensuring contacts are kept up-to date in a central database.

· To build relationships with media, managing and delivering an effective media relations service, working with NHS and other key partners.

· Contribute to the management of external suppliers.

· Responsible for maintaining and improving of press office presence including introduction of online platform.

Working as part of a team:

· Advise, support and brief colleagues and volunteers on press releases and undertaking media interviews.

· Work closely with the Marketing and Communications Manager and digital staff regarding online content in order to deliver rich content to support media activity.

Essential Candidate Criteria

· Educated to degree level or professional experience in a relevant discipline.

· Demonstrable experience (minimum 3 years) of working in a media environment, e.g., in a press office, PR agency or as a journalist.

· Demonstrable experience of working on charity or successful consumer-facing or behaviour change campaigns.

· Able to demonstrate effective use of social media to support PR campaigns.

· Understanding of press and broadcasting methods.

· Excellent oral and written communication skills.

· Project and time management experience.

· An understanding of the sensitivities of working for a charity, where reputation and local support are as important as the care and quality of the services delivered, together with a strong awareness of the external communications environment.

· Hold a driving license and have access to a car at all times for business use.

· Successful PVG check.

Desirable Candidate Criteria

· Member of industry community/ professional body for public relations practitioners.
